BC> We have dumpers 4, I can include as much of the amanda.conf file as BC> anyone wants. Have you TOLD AMANDA about the doubled space she can use? (use-parameter in the holdingdisk-section). If you use spindle-numbers in your disklist make sure you don`t set the same for the both DLEs you want to parallelize. BC> Run Time (hrs:min) 10:58 BC> Dump Time (hrs:min) 10:18 There isn�t much parallelism going on, as these numbers tell us.
